INDIANAPOLIS --? Steelers cornerback Joe Haden left Sunday's 20-17 win over the Colts with a fracture in his left leg. Coach Mike Tomlin said after the game that Haden broke his fibula and is out indefinitely. "Joe Haden has a fibula fracture," Tomlin said. "It's high on his leg. I don't know what that means."
